SuperSulf process refers to an innovative reactor design consisting of internal cooling and heating thermoplate exchangers where it is filled by the Claus type catalysts between plates in the SRU and hydrogenation catalysts in the tail gas unit. SuperSulf reactor consists of 3 reactor zones in the sulfur recovery which operates as a SubDewPoint process where the mode of operation are controlled by switching valves on the utilities streams high pressure steam and high quality water and steam where the first 2 zones operate as hot and cold and switches to cold and hot where the produced sulfur is condensed. The third zone operates as cold all the time where consists of the last sulfur condenser by producing Low pressure steam. The tail gas unit consists of 2 reactor zones of hydrogenation reactor and hydrolysis reactor with internal plate cooling then followed by the tail gas amine with a selective solvent. The thermal incineration system can meet less than 50 ppmv of SO2 and with caustic incineration less than 10 ppmv of SO2 resulting zero emission.
